Biography

Michael DeHaven Newsom has served in the positions of Assistant Dean for Admissions and Associate Dean for Academic Affairs. Professor Newsom joined the law faculty in 1975 and was promoted to Associate Professor in 1979. He was promoted to Professor of Law in 1982.

Professor Newsom’s teaching and research interests include Trusts, Wills, and Estates; Real Property; and the law of Church and State. He is currently engaged in writing articles on Prohibition and Jurisprudence and the role of theology and race in both.

Professor Newsom received the Distinguished Faculty Author Award from the President and Provost of the University in 2001 and 2002 He serves on the Committee on Appointments, Promotion, and Tenure and the Committee on Admissions and Financial Aid. Along with Professors Spencer H. Boyer, Henry H. Jones, Warner Lawson, and Richard Thornell, Professor Newsom founded the Silver Forum, an organization of the senior members of the law faculty.
